Pub Date: December 2012 Pages: 299 Language: Chinese in Publisher: Tsinghua University Press Tsinghua University Press. the 12th Five-Year Plan materials: methods of mathematical physics (engineering use) the Engineering faculties undergraduate engineering mathematics courses and writing. The book consists of complex variables. integral transforms. special functions and mathematical physics equations of three parts. 16 chapters. each introduced plural and complex function. analytic functions. complex function of integral power series expansion of analytic functions. residue theory and its applications. conformal mapping. Fourier transform. Laplace transform. special functions and mathematical physics definite solution of the problem. the traveling wave method and integral transformation method of separation of variables. Green's function method and other methods content.
